So now that the game guide is almost 100% updated, I thought I'd take a stab at set pieces, set bonuses and how they compare; which element prefers which set, and legendary pieces that probably favorable to a set item. This is not intended to be a "BiS" list. This is intended to be a hard look at how set pieces compare to each other at End Game and to other non-set legendaries. Couple things to note is Tal Rasha *does* scale to 70 so stats are the exact same as Vyr's and Firebird's, and it will be *very* hard for a non-set legendary to complete with a +500 int 2-peicie set bonus in most cases;

On the belt slot I REALLY think that tal rashas can't compare to Harrington Waistguard. It's a beast of an item and the uptime is fenomenal tbh, there are only a very few times you wont have the buff up when it matters and then you can always kite kite kite until you find a chest/body/rock to turn over.
100% damage increase is just to insane to not have.
Had one of these belts in the bank, on first glance I didn't think the bonus seemed that great (thinking it was literally only chests). But from your approval of it I decided to go give it a try, and holy shit. That belt is game-changing. Procs on bodies, armor and weapon racks, loose rocks, things like cocooned victims (which are really just bodies), and of course, chests. In some places these things are everywhere.
I don't think I'll ever use another belt. I pop something, get the buff, and elites just melt in like 3 seconds (T1). HELM
http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/tal-rashas-guise-of-wisdom vs http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/firebirds-plume are the set peices in the head slot. These are roughly interchangable; both with potential to be absolutely amazing rolls. The differences between them aren't much; Equipping tal's set is slightly harder to do, in exchange for it's superiority for Ice, Lightning and Arcane elements. Firebird's has the possibility of ApoC, which tal's helm cannot roll.
CHEST
http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/tal-rashas-relentless-pursuit or http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/firebirds-breast or http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/vyrs-astonishing-aura are the choices here. Tal's and Vyr's are VERY close. On average, Tal's chest will roll better due to because it comes standard with Int, Vit, and 3 sockets - meaning you will always be able to pick up +% life or All Resist with a mystic if you didn't get it initially. Vyr's set is harder to equip, because it only has four peices to Tal's six, so the nod goes to Vyr's if you got an awesome roll. Fire will almost certainly go with http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/cindercoat if they don't require another peice of Firebird's.
BELT
http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/tal-rashas-brace only Tal's set has a belt slot; so Tal's in the one you want. It helps that it's pretty easy to get Vit/Int/All Resist and Life % tal's belt, which translates into a nice +toughness boost.
GLOVES:
This is a hard slot. There's pretty good options here. http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/vyrs-grasping-gauntlets or http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/firebirds-talons are the set peices; but they are competing with http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/frostburn and http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/magefist It will likely break down to Ice prefering Frostburns, Arcane taking Vyr's, and Fire going Magefist. Lightning is free to pick up whichever peice they want.
SOURCE:
http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/tal-rashas-unwavering-glare or http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/firebirds-eye are the set sources; Firebird's eye is obviously superior if you are fire; Tal Rasha's being the best if you are one of the other three elements. Depending on your build, you may prefer one of the legendary sources with a unique affix; the list can be here (http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/orb/#type=legendary)
PANTS:
http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/firebirds-down or http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/vyrs-fantastic-finery Vyr's is superior is most cases here, unless for some reason you use a signature spell end-game you Firebird happens to roll. Additionally, Vyr's set is harder to equip due to the limited set choices; Long story short, if you find set pants, hope it's Vyrs and not Firebirds - unless you are Fire.
Shoulders:
http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/firebirds-pinions. One choice. You probably want Vitality as your +additional affix, If your build does not utilize Black Hole, you may chance your BH affix to Life % or +All Resist.
Amulet:
http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/tal-rashas-allegiance is the only set choice here, with stiff competition from http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/moonlight-ward if Arcane. Other legendaries can be competitive here, but probably NOT optimal when you start factoring in set bonuses.
BOOTS:
http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/firebirds-tarsi or http://us.battle.net/d3/en/item/vyrs-swaggering-stance here. Vyr's rolls a +spender skill while Firebird's rolls +Movement speed. Both are good stats and ideally you get your spender AND movement speed on whichever you use.
